Rwandan politician Diana Rwigara announced her participation in the presidential elections to be held on July 15; Her corresponding statement appeared on her X page (formerly Twitter) on May 8.
Diana Rwigara, daughter of prominent Rwandan businessman Assinapol Rwigara, has become the fourth candidate to announce her participation in the presidential elections. Earlier, incumbent President Paul Kagame, Democratic Green Party leader Frank Habineza and independent candidate Philip Mpaimana announced their candidacies.
Rwigara previously attempted to run for president in 2017, but his candidacy was rejected by the electoral commission due to alleged fraud. This decision generated criticism from Western countries and human rights organizations.
Diana Rwigara’s father, Assinapol Rwigara, was a prominent businessman who made his fortune in industry and real estate. In the 1990s, he actively financed Paul Kagame’s Rwandan Patriotic Front.
The presentation of candidatures of candidates for the presidential and parliamentary elections will take place from May 17 to 30. The final list of candidates will be announced on June 14.
